In 1902, George Donald Denison entered the world in Marlbank, Hastings, Ontario, Canada, born to Theodore Denison And Sarah Schermerhorn. In 1921, George Donald Denison resided in Hungerford Township, Hastings East, Ontario, Canad. George Donald Denison married Edna Verna Gray, and had children including Baby Dennison, Daniel Malcolm Dennison, Donald D Denison, Dorothy Verna Baker, Frederick Ralph Denison, Infant Twin Denison, James Denison, Maurice George Denison, Reta Denison, Ruth Marjorie Denison, Theodore Denison. George Donald Denison passed away in 1971 in Tweed, Hastings, Ontario, Canada.
